§ 52:27D-200 — Variances from regulations
New Jersey·Title 52 STATE GOVERNMENT, DEPARTMENTS AND OFFICERS
a. Upon the application of the owner of a building, structure or premises, the enforcing agency may grant variances from the requirements of a regulation issued pursuant to this act. No variance shall be granted in a particular case unless the enforcing agency shall find:
(1)that strict compliance with the regulation would result in undue hardship to the owner; and (2) that the variance, if granted, will not unreasonably jeopardize the safety of intended occupants, fire fighters and the public generally. b. An application for a variance pursuant to this section shall be filed in writing with the enforcing agency and shall set forth specifically:
(1)a statement of the requirements of the regulation from which a variance is sought;
